티스토리 뷰

   input 태그에 값을 입력하고 전송 버튼을 눌렀을 때 체크하는 것이 아니라, 입력하는 중에 실시간으로 사용자가 값을 맞게 입력했는지 표시해주기 위한 소스다.


   원래는 몇 개만 적용하려고 각각에 맞는 스크립트를 코딩했으나, 이걸 프로젝트 전체 인풋값에 적용하는 것으로 지시가 떨어져서..ㄷㄷ;;; 공통 함수가 필요하게 됐다.


   그래서 짠 로직이 아래 소스...


HTML




CSS

.redText{display: block;color: red;margin-left:10px;} .greenText{display: block;color: green;margin-left:10px;}



   Javascript는 파일로 첨부한다.

   여기에 올리려고 하니, 반복문에서 깨져서 소스가 어그러진다.



spanValidation.js






>코딩 후기 :

   자바스크립트 함수명이 string으로 넘어가는 바람에 이 부분에서 애를 좀 먹었다.

   자바스크립트는 개발자도구로도 에러 찾기가 많이 힘든데..ㅠㅠ 이럴 땐 typeof를 이용하면 도움이 많이 된다.

   자바스크립트는 데이터 타입을 따로 정의하는 방식이 아니라서(그냥 죄다 var) 대게의 오류들이 타입이 달라서 생기는 경우가 많은 듯하다.



댓글
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day
«   2024/12   »
1 2 3 4 5 6 7
8 9 10 11 12 13 14
15 16 17 18 19 20 21
22 23 24 25 26 27 28
29 30 31
글 보관함